
About The Event
Laddu” is a compelling and relatable theatrical production that explores the realities of modern relationships through the lives of two couples—**Appu and Jugnu**.
Once believers in love and the idea of choosing their own partners, both Appu and Jugnu dreamt of love marriages. However, like many around us, destiny had other plans. Circumstances, family pressures, and societal expectations lead them into arranged marriages, reshaping the course of their lives.
What follows is not just a story of marriage, but a journey into the complexities that come after. As they step into their new relationships, they are confronted with emotional gaps, unfulfilled expectations, communication breakdowns, and the constant comparison between what they once desired and what they now live.
Through moments of humor, tension, and raw honesty, “Laddu” captures the silent struggles that many couples go through but rarely express. The play questions the idea of compatibility, challenges romantic illusions, and reflects on how individuals adjust, compromise, or sometimes lose themselves within relationships.
With engaging performances and realistic storytelling, the play gradually unfolds layers of truth—revealing that marriage is not just about love or arrangement, but about understanding, acceptance, and emotional courage.
“Laddu” ultimately invites the audience to reflect:
*Is happiness something we find in relationships, or something we learn to create within them?*
